Case Study:

University of Maryland Medical System

Over time, University of Maryland Medical System (UMMS) had acquired a number of different hospitals scattered throughout the state. Each hospital had a different system, and coordinating patient transport services became akin to managing a “patchwork quilt” – fragmented and lacking cohesion – posing significant challenges when it comes to ensuring timely and efficient patient care.

In this case study, you’ll see how Ryde Central helped UMMS automate the patient transport process and achieved efficiency and timeliness for patient transport.
